Reading a knot pattern

Learn to read a chart so any MaMaBao pattern makes sense at a glance.

Beginner20 min4 steps

  1. Step 1

    A knot pattern is a simple grid: one square is one knot, one line is one row. The bottom line is always the first row you weave.

  2. Step 2

    The two colours printed on the chart match the two strip colours in your kit. Tick off each finished row with a pencil so you never lose your place.

  3. Step 3

    Odd rows read left to right and even rows right to left — the same direction your cord travels. If you are unsure, follow the small arrows in the margin.

  4. Step 4

    Count before you knot: check the knot count of the next row against the chart before folding. Catching a miscount one row early saves undoing a whole evening's work.
